Multiple cross-site scripting (XSS) vulnerabilities in Lotus Domino iNotes Client 6.5.4 and 7.0 allow remote attackers to inject arbitrary web script or HTML via (1) an email subject; (2) an encoded javascript URI, as demonstrated using "java script:"; or (3) when the Domino Web Access ActiveX control is not installed, via an email attachment filename.

IBM Lotus Domino 6.x/7.0 - iNotes JavaScript: Filter Bypass
---
source: https://www.securityfocus.com/bid/16577/info
IBM Lotus Domino iNotes is prone to multiple HTML- and script-injection vulnerabilities.
These vulnerabilities can allow attackers to carry out a variety of attacks, including theft of cookie-based authentication credentials.
A proof of concept example for the issue exploited through a 'javascript:' URI is available:
